As aforementioned, the inverter is interconnected to the grid, so it should fulfill the grid standards as well. These standards includes power quality, grid ride through capability and islanding prevention. The inverter is known as voltage source inverter when the input of the inverter is a constant DC. . Grid-connected PV inverters have traditionally been thought as active power sources with an emphasis on maximizing power extraction from the PV modules. While maximizing power transfer remains a top priority, utility grid stability is now widely acknowledged to benefit from several auxiliary. .
